These ten true tales of 15th-century explorers bring history to life, with accounts of the exploits of Christopher Columbus, Bartholomew Diaz, Ponce de Leon, and others. "Fritz approaches (the salient facts) with playful irreverence; accordingly, the frequently traveled material can seem refreshingly new".--"Publishers Weekly", starred review. An IRA Teachers' Choice and "Parenting" Magazine Best Book of the Year.
